Numerical Simulation of Flow Field with Moving and Deforming Objects

Abstract: Infiltration of blast waves in a structure with limited opening in the front wall is investigated numerically.Numerical methods deal with generation of moving and deforming unstructured mesh,moving boundary condition and topological change of geometry are used to blast-structure interactions.Movements of door located at the opening,collision of door with a baffle,fracture of door and displacement of fragment are considered.It is concluded that the methods are suitable to deal with blast-structure interaction.

Key words: moving boundary, numerical simulation, blast infiltration, fracture, fragment distribution
